,可以考慮縮減問題 空間,即縮減JPEG標(biāo)準(zhǔn)規(guī)定的量化表的取值范圍。對(duì)8*8圖像塊做DCT變換后,低頻系數(shù) 集中在矩陣靠近左上角的位置,高頻系數(shù)則集中在矩陣靠近右下角的位置,一般來說,圖像 的大部分能量和信息都集中在低頻部分。因此,從降低比特和縮減問題空間出發(fā),設(shè)計(jì)預(yù)設(shè) 公式如下:
[0087]
【主權(quán)項(xiàng)】
1. 一種量化表處理方法,其特征在于,包括: 根據(jù)預(yù)設(shè)公式確定初始JPEG標(biāo)準(zhǔn)量化表中的量化值; 依據(jù)優(yōu)化目標(biāo)函數(shù)確定所述預(yù)設(shè)量化表; 輸出預(yù)設(shè)量化表,其中,所述輸出預(yù)設(shè)量化表中的量化值使得優(yōu)化目標(biāo)函數(shù)值最小,所 述優(yōu)化目標(biāo)函數(shù)值依據(jù)所述目標(biāo)圖像與壓縮后的壓縮圖像的失真率確定。
2. -種圖像壓縮處理方法,其特征在于,在根據(jù)權(quán)利要求1所述的方法輸出所述預(yù)設(shè) 量化表之后,還包括: 對(duì)一個(gè)或多個(gè)子塊進(jìn)行離散余弦DCT變換后獲得的DCT系數(shù)采用所述預(yù)設(shè)量化表進(jìn)行 量化,其中,所述一個(gè)或多個(gè)子塊通過對(duì)用于壓縮的目標(biāo)圖像進(jìn)行劃分獲得; 依據(jù)采用所述預(yù)設(shè)量化表進(jìn)行量化后的所述DCT系數(shù)對(duì)所述目標(biāo)圖像進(jìn)行壓縮編碼 處理。
3. 根據(jù)權(quán)利要求2所述的方法,其特征在于,在依據(jù)采用所述預(yù)設(shè)量化表進(jìn)行量化后 的所述DCT系數(shù)對(duì)所述目標(biāo)圖像進(jìn)行壓縮編碼之前,還包括: 根據(jù)預(yù)設(shè)重置位變換規(guī)則對(duì)所述DCT系數(shù)進(jìn)行重置位變換; 依據(jù)重置位后的DCT系數(shù)對(duì)所述目標(biāo)圖像進(jìn)行壓縮編碼處理。
4. 根據(jù)權(quán)利要求3所述的方法,其特征在于,所述預(yù)設(shè)重置位變換規(guī)則包括以下至少 之一: 通過所述目標(biāo)圖像劃分子塊的坐標(biāo)位置進(jìn)行重置位變換; 通過結(jié)合所述目標(biāo)圖像子塊局部興趣點(diǎn)坐標(biāo)位置與所述目標(biāo)圖像子塊坐標(biāo)位置進(jìn)行 重置位變換。
5. 根據(jù)權(quán)利要求4所述的方法,其特征在于,在所述預(yù)設(shè)重置位變換規(guī)則為通過所述 目標(biāo)圖像劃分子塊的坐標(biāo)位置進(jìn)行重置位變換的情況下,根據(jù)所述預(yù)設(shè)重置位變換規(guī)則對(duì) 所述DCT系數(shù)進(jìn)行重置位變換包括: 確定所述一個(gè)或多個(gè)子塊距離圖像中心的距離; 依據(jù)確定的所述距離對(duì)所述DCT系數(shù)所包括的直流系數(shù)和交流系數(shù)進(jìn)行變換。
6. 根據(jù)權(quán)利要求5所述的方法,其特征在于,依據(jù)確定的所述距離對(duì)所述DCT系數(shù)所包 括的直流系數(shù)和交流系數(shù)進(jìn)行變換包括以下至少之一: 在所述一個(gè)或多個(gè)子塊在所述目標(biāo)圖像寬度與高度上、下、左、右最外層10%的情況 下,只保留所述DCT系數(shù)的直流系數(shù)不變,將所述DCT系數(shù)的交流系數(shù)變換為0 ; 在所述一個(gè)或多個(gè)子塊在所述目標(biāo)圖像寬度與高度上、下、左、右最外層10%至20%的 情況下,保留所述DCT系數(shù)的直流系數(shù)和按照ZIG-ZAG掃描順序得到前4個(gè)交流系數(shù)不變, 將剩余的交流系數(shù)交換為〇 ; 在所述一個(gè)或多個(gè)子塊在所述目標(biāo)圖像寬度與高度上、下、左、右最外側(cè)20%至25%的 情況下,保留所述DCT系數(shù)的直流系數(shù)和按照ZIG-ZAG掃描順序得到前8個(gè)交流系數(shù)不變, 將剩余的交流系數(shù)變換為〇 ; 在不滿足上述條件至少之一的情況下,對(duì)所述DCT系數(shù)所包括的直流系數(shù)和交流系數(shù) 保持不變。
7. 根據(jù)權(quán)利要求4所述的方法,其特征在于,在所述預(yù)設(shè)重置位變換規(guī)則為通過結(jié)合 所述目標(biāo)圖像子塊局部興趣點(diǎn)坐標(biāo)位置與所述目標(biāo)圖像子塊坐標(biāo)位置進(jìn)行重置位變換的 情況下,根據(jù)所述預(yù)設(shè)重置位變換規(guī)則對(duì)所述DCT系數(shù)進(jìn)行重置位變換包括: 確定所述目標(biāo)圖像的興趣點(diǎn)區(qū)域; 判斷所述一個(gè)或多個(gè)子塊是否屬于所述興趣點(diǎn)區(qū)域; 在判斷結(jié)果為是的情況下,保留所述DCT系數(shù)不變,和/或,在判斷結(jié)果為否的情況下, 保留所述DCT系數(shù)的直流系數(shù)和按照ZIG-ZAG掃描順序得到前4個(gè)交流系數(shù)不變,將剩余 的交流系數(shù)交換為0。
8. -種量化表處理裝置,其特征在于,包括: 第一確定模塊,用于根據(jù)預(yù)設(shè)公式確定初始JPEG標(biāo)準(zhǔn)量化表中的量化值; 第二確定模塊,用于依據(jù)優(yōu)化目標(biāo)函數(shù)確定所述預(yù)設(shè)量化表; 輸出模塊,用于輸出預(yù)設(shè)量化表,其中,所述輸出預(yù)設(shè)量化表中的量化值使得優(yōu)化目標(biāo) 函數(shù)值最小,所述優(yōu)化目標(biāo)函數(shù)值依據(jù)所述目標(biāo)圖像與壓縮后的壓縮圖像的失真率確定。
9. 一種圖像壓縮處理裝置,其特征在于,所述裝置包括: 量化模塊,用于對(duì)一個(gè)或多個(gè)子塊進(jìn)行離散余弦DCT變換后獲得的DCT系數(shù)采用所述 預(yù)設(shè)量化表進(jìn)行量化,其中,所述一個(gè)或多個(gè)子塊通過對(duì)用于壓縮的目標(biāo)圖像進(jìn)行劃分獲 得,所述預(yù)設(shè)量化表由權(quán)利要求8所述的量化表處理裝置獲得; 處理模塊,用于依據(jù)采用所述預(yù)設(shè)量化表進(jìn)行量化后的所述DCT系數(shù)對(duì)所述目標(biāo)圖像 進(jìn)行壓縮編碼處理。
10. 根據(jù)權(quán)利要求9中所述的裝置,其特征在于,還包括: 變換模塊,用于根據(jù)預(yù)設(shè)重置位變換規(guī)則對(duì)所述DCT系數(shù)進(jìn)行重置位變換; 所述處理模塊還用于依據(jù)重置位后的DCT系數(shù)對(duì)所述目標(biāo)圖像進(jìn)行壓縮編碼處理。
11. 根據(jù)權(quán)利要求10所述的裝置,其特征在于,所述變換模塊包括: 第一確定單元,用于在所述預(yù)設(shè)重置位變換規(guī)則為通過所述目標(biāo)圖像劃分子塊的坐標(biāo) 位置進(jìn)行重置位變換的情況下,確定所述一個(gè)或多個(gè)子塊距離圖像中心的距離; 第一變換單元,用于依據(jù)確定的所述距離對(duì)所述DCT系數(shù)所包括的直流系數(shù)和交流系 數(shù)進(jìn)行變換。
12. 根據(jù)權(quán)利要求11所述的裝置,其特征在于,所述第一變換單元包括以下至少之一: 第一變換子單元,用于在所述一個(gè)或多個(gè)子塊在所述目標(biāo)圖像寬度與高度上、下、左、 右最外層10%的情況下,只保留所述DCT系數(shù)的直流系數(shù)不變,將所述DCT系數(shù)的交流系數(shù) 變換為〇 ; 第二變換子單元,用于在所述一個(gè)或多個(gè)子塊在所述目標(biāo)圖像寬度與高度上、下、左、 右最外層10%至20%的情況下,保留所述DCT系數(shù)的直流系數(shù)和按照ZIG-ZAG掃描順序得 到前4個(gè)交流系數(shù)不變,將剩余的交流系數(shù)交換為0 ; 第三變換子單元,用于在所述一個(gè)或多個(gè)子塊在所述目標(biāo)圖像寬度與高度上、下、左、 右最外側(cè)20%至25%的情況下,保留所述DCT系數(shù)的直流系數(shù)和按照ZIG-ZAG掃描順序得 到前8個(gè)交流系數(shù)不變,將剩余的交流系數(shù)變換為0 ; 第四變換子單元,用于在不滿足上述條件至少之一的情況下,對(duì)所述DCT系數(shù)所包括 的直流系數(shù)和交流系數(shù)保持不變。
13. 根據(jù)權(quán)利要求10所述的裝置,其特征在于,所述變換模塊包括: 第二確定單元,用于在所述預(yù)設(shè)重置位變換規(guī)則為通過結(jié)合所述目標(biāo)圖像子塊局部興 趣點(diǎn)坐標(biāo)位置與所述目標(biāo)圖像子塊坐標(biāo)位置進(jìn)行重置位變換的情況下確定所述目標(biāo)圖像 的興趣點(diǎn)區(qū)域; 判斷單元,用于判斷所述一個(gè)或多個(gè)子塊是否屬于所述興趣點(diǎn)區(qū)域; 第二變換單元,用于在判斷結(jié)果為是的情況下,保留所述DCT系數(shù)不變,和/或,在判斷 結(jié)果為否的情況下,保留所述DCT系數(shù)的直流系數(shù)和按照ZIG-ZAG掃描順序得到前4個(gè)交 流系數(shù)不變,將剩余的交流系數(shù)變換為0。
14. 一種終端,其特征在于,包括權(quán)利要求8所述的量化表處理裝置和/或權(quán)利要求9 至13中任一項(xiàng)所述的圖像壓縮處理裝置。
15. -種圖像搜索系統(tǒng),其特征在于,包括服務(wù)器和權(quán)利要求14所述終端,其中,所述 服務(wù)器用于:接收來自所述終端的壓縮圖像;將所述壓縮圖像還原為所述目標(biāo)圖像;在對(duì) 所述目標(biāo)圖像進(jìn)行檢索獲取到檢索結(jié)果之后,將所述檢索結(jié)果反饋給所述終端,所述壓縮 圖像依據(jù)對(duì)目標(biāo)圖像劃分為一個(gè)或多個(gè)子塊進(jìn)行離散余弦DCT變換后獲得的DCT系數(shù)進(jìn)行 壓縮編碼獲得。
【專利摘要】本發(fā)明提供了一種量化表、圖像壓縮處理方法、裝置、終端及圖像搜索系統(tǒng),該方法包括:根據(jù)預(yù)設(shè)公式確定初始JPEG標(biāo)準(zhǔn)量化表中的量化值;依據(jù)優(yōu)化目標(biāo)函數(shù)確定所述預(yù)設(shè)量化表;輸出預(yù)設(shè)量化表,其中,所述輸出預(yù)設(shè)量化表中的量化值使得優(yōu)化目標(biāo)函數(shù)值最小,所述優(yōu)化目標(biāo)函數(shù)值依據(jù)所述目標(biāo)圖像與壓縮后的壓縮圖像的失真率確定;依據(jù)采用預(yù)設(shè)量化表進(jìn)行量化后的DCT系數(shù)對(duì)目標(biāo)圖像進(jìn)行壓縮編碼處理。通過本發(fā)明,解決了相關(guān)技術(shù)中采用JPEG標(biāo)準(zhǔn)量化表壓縮的查詢圖片的比特?cái)?shù)無法滿足低性能移動(dòng)設(shè)備的傳輸性能的問題,達(dá)到了大大提高了圖片壓縮的操作性,提高用戶體驗(yàn)的效果。
【IPC分類】H04N19-625, H04N19-176
【公開號(hào)】CN104581158
【申請(qǐng)?zhí)枴緾N201310486293
【發(fā)明人】段凌宇, 陸平, 王一同, 賈霞, 羅圣美, 劉明, 黃鐵軍
【申請(qǐng)人】中興通訊股份有限公司, 北京大學(xué)
【公開日】2015年4月29日
【申請(qǐng)日】2013年10月16日